DE   RecName: Full=HTH-type transcriptional activator AmpR;
GN   Name=ampR;
OS   Citrobacter freundii.
OC   Bacteria; Proteobacteria; Gammaproteobacteria; Enterobacterales;
OC   Enterobacteriaceae; Citrobacter; Citrobacter freundii complex.

CC   -!- FUNCTION: Regulates the expression of the beta-lactamase gene.
CC       Represses cephalosporinase (AmpC) in the presence of beta-lactams and
CC       induces it in the absence of them.
CC   -!- SUBCELLULAR LOCATION: Cytoplasm.
CC   -!- SIMILARITY: Belongs to the LysR transcriptional regulatory family.
CC       {ECO:0000305}.
